2.  Strategic Leadership: J Batt Joins as Athletic Director

In a bold and future-focused move, Michigan State hired J Batt, the dynamic athletic director from Georgia Tech, to lead the program into its next era of success. Known for his innovative approach to athletic management and proven success in fundraising and program development, Batt is expected to elevate MSU’s brand and performance across all sports.

His appointment also reflects MSU’s commitment to staying competitive not just on the field, but in the broader arms race of college sports administration.

6.  What J Batt’s Leadership Means Long-Term

J Batt brings a holistic vision, emphasizing both athletic excellence and academic integrity. At Georgia Tech, he was credited with increasing donor contributions and expanding facilities. Expectations are high that under his watch, MSU will continue to attract top talent, modernize its athletic infrastructure, and enhance NIL opportunities for athletes.
